Blue Pride,
In theory your assessment is correct. Louie Zamora bleeds blue and I am sure was feeling a tug at his heart to see El Rancho lose like they did on Friday night. However, the facts remain that Zamora would not have been offered the head coaching job because the job was to be given to a "walk-on" coach. Zamora completed his graduate studies at Whittier College, and was ready for start working as a teacher. El Rancho couldnt offer him nor his staff a teaching position. It would have been disastrous if he would have been given the job, because he would not have had much of a staff. Too much for someone so young. Zepeda is a good guy who was thrown in the fire this season, remember he started one week before spring practice. Also, add to that that there is no booster club, and that the entire coaching staff from top to bottom outside of Sauceda, are walk-ons! We need to exercise patience, this team is young with 35-40 underclassmen. We have had three coaches in three years, let there be some stability and let the coaches coach. I agree with some of your thoughts...Harshbarger should be at corner or safety. But remember, we are depleted at the linebacker position. Velasquez who was expected to contribute was ineligible, Sanchez didnt play, Collindres I believe is out for the season, Turner lacks aggressiveness this season...what is a coaching staff to do? I concur with your other statement regarding Baldwin and some of the younger players. I would like to see if he could handle some carries out of the running back position.
Lastly, I think the coaching staff will receive additional assistance at the end of the season. I expect this process to take two to three years to fully implement Zepeda's vision. Lets support out team win or lose.
